Job description
We are looking for a Senior System Design Engineer with strong expertise in CyberArk and infrastructure engineering to support and evolve a self-hosted Privileged Access Management (PAM) ecosystem within a large enterprise environment.
This role combines system design, security engineering, infrastructure operations, and automation, with a strong focus on reliability, security, and scalability.
What you will be doing
System Design & Engineering
- Translate business and technical requirements into scalable infrastructure designs
- Evaluate architectural trade-offs and technical design decisions
- Ensure systems meet security, performance, and scalability requirements
- Support deployment and implementation of designed solutions
Infrastructure Operations
- Manage and support enterprise Windows and Linux environments
- Ensure platform stability, performance, and capacity management
- Participate in on-call support when required
- Drive operational excellence across production systems
CyberArk & Security Engineering
- Engineer and maintain the CyberArk PAM platform
- Support privileged access management operations
- Strengthen authentication and access control mechanisms
- Contribute to cyber risk mitigation and secure-by-design practices
Automation & Development
- Develop automation using Python and scripting tools (Shell, etc.)
- Integrate systems through REST APIs
- Automate operational and security workflows
- Reduce manual effort and improve efficiency
Incident & Problem Management
- Handle complex infrastructure and security incidents
- Perform root cause analysis (RCA)
- Improve system resilience and operational stability
Documentation & Collaboration
- Maintain technical documentation
- Collaborate with infrastructure, security, and engineering teams
- Share knowledge and contribute to continuous improvement
